Produktbeschreibung
This book highlights the efficiency of geoinformatics to promote sustainable human settlements in hilly regions of India. It also serves as a platform to discuss the unique challenges and opportunities faced by hill settlements in fostering sustainable human settlements. With a focus on physical planning, environment, tourism, and climate change, this book equips planners, policymakers, and practitioners with the knowledge and tools necessary to make informed decisions and develop resilient strategies for these regions.
